Key Features to Look For

When you shop for smoker charcoal, look closely at these features. They tell you how well the charcoal will perform.

1. Burn Time and Consistency
  • Long Burn Time: You want charcoal that burns for many hours. This is important for long smokes, like briskets or ribs. Check the package for estimated burn times.
  • Even Burning: Good charcoal lights easily and burns at a steady temperature. Uneven burning means you constantly adjust your vents.
2. Smoke Profile and Flavor
  • Clean Smoke: High-quality charcoal produces “thin, blue smoke.” This smoke adds flavor without making the food taste bitter or acrid.
  • Flavor Infusion: Some charcoals, especially those made from specific hardwoods, add a richer flavor than standard briquettes.

Important Materials: What is Your Charcoal Made Of?

The material used dictates the flavor and how long the charcoal lasts.

Natural Hardwood Lump Charcoal

This is charcoal made directly from burning pieces of real wood, like hickory, oak, or cherry. It lights fast and burns hot. Lump charcoal provides the purest, most authentic smoke flavor.

Charcoal Briquettes

Briquettes are uniform, pillow-shaped pieces. Manufacturers mix charcoal dust with binders (like starch) and sometimes additives to help them light. They burn slower and more consistently than lump charcoal. They are often cheaper.

Natural vs. “Instant Light”
  • Natural Charcoal: Only contains wood or carbon. This is the best choice for flavor.
  • Instant Light Briquettes: These often contain lighter fluid soaked in. Avoid these for smoking. The chemicals ruin the taste of your meat.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

Quality control greatly affects your smoking success.

Improving Quality: Purity and Density
  • Purity: The best charcoal has very few fillers or chemical additives. Pure lump charcoal is usually the highest quality in terms of flavor.
  • Density: Denser pieces of charcoal or briquettes last longer because they have less air trapped inside.
Reducing Quality: Ash and Dust
  • Excess Ash: If your bag is full of fine black dust (ash), the charcoal will burn out quickly. Too much ash also clogs your smoker vents.
  • Inconsistent Sizing: Very small pieces burn up too fast. Very large chunks take a long time to catch fire. Uniformity matters.

User Experience and Use Cases

Think about how you like to smoke. This helps narrow down your choice.

For Quick Grilling and High Heat

If you are just searing steaks or grilling burgers quickly, **lump charcoal** is great. It reaches high temperatures fast.

For Low-and-Slow Smoking

For long cooks (8+ hours), many pitmasters prefer **all-natural briquettes** or high-quality, dense **lump charcoal**. Briquettes offer easier temperature control over long periods.

Flavor Pairing

Consider the wood source. Oak provides a balanced smoke perfect for beef. Fruitwoods like apple or cherry work well with pork and poultry.


10 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Smoker Charcoal

Q: Should I use lump charcoal or briquettes for smoking?

A: Both work well. Lump charcoal burns hotter and offers a purer wood flavor. Briquettes burn longer and more consistently, which is easier for beginners during long cooks.

Q: What is “thin, blue smoke”?

A: Thin, blue smoke is the ideal smoke for cooking. It means the wood or charcoal is burning cleanly and adds great flavor without making the food taste harsh or bitter.

Q: Can I use charcoal meant for grilling in my smoker?

A: Yes, but only if it is all-natural. Avoid briquettes labeled “instant light” because the lighter fluid residue will taint your food.

Q: How much charcoal do I need for a 12-hour smoke?

A: This depends heavily on your smoker type and the weather. For a large smoker, you might need 15 to 20 pounds of good quality charcoal to maintain temperature over 12 hours.

Q: Why does my charcoal produce so much white smoke?

A: White smoke often means the fuel is not hot enough or there is too much unburnt fuel. You need to wait until the white smoke turns thin and blue for the best results.

Q: Does the brand of charcoal really matter?

A: Yes, the brand matters a lot. Better brands use better wood sources and fewer fillers, leading to cleaner burns and better flavor.

Q: How do I store leftover charcoal?

A: Store charcoal in a dry, sealed container. Keep it off concrete floors if possible. Moisture ruins charcoal, making it hard to light next time.

Q: What are the best wood types to look for in lump charcoal?

A: Oak, hickory, and pecan are popular choices because they offer strong, classic barbecue flavors that pair well with most meats.

Q: Is charcoal better than wood chunks for smoking?

A: Charcoal acts as your steady heat source. Wood chunks or chips are added *to* the charcoal to generate the smoke flavor. You need both for a traditional smoke.

Q: How do I get my charcoal to last longer?

A: Control the airflow. Use less charcoal to start, and keep your vents mostly closed (but not completely shut). Less oxygen means a slower, longer burn.
